Summary
We will learn:
- The marketing tricks that leave us feeling like we always need more.
- Why our intentions to donate often fail.
- The 7 emotional clutter magnets and how to work through them.
Have you ever noticed how clutter affects your mental health?
Wouldn’t it be amazing to walk into a home that feels inviting? Or to start daydreaming about your next big goal and not have an interfering thought saying, “Well, maybe I’ll get to that after I finally organize these drawers,” only to get overwhelmed and not do anything?
So what can we do to finally stop attracting clutter and make space for happiness?
That’s what we’re talking about today.
Our guest is Tracy McCubbin. While working for a major television director in Los Angeles, Tracy discovered she had the ability to see through any mess and clearly envision a clutter-free space. She is the author of “Making Space, Clutter-Free: The Last Book on Decluttering You’ll Ever Need” and “Make Space for Happiness.” She is also a regularly featured expert in the media, including The Washington Post, The Wall Street Journal, Goop, Home & Family, Real Simple, Mindbodygreen, NBC, KTLA Morning Show, KCAL9, and more.
